When angry, count ten before you speak; if very angry a hundred. Thomas Jefferson
Anger in its time and place / May assume a kind of grace. / It must have some reason in it / And not last beyond a minute. Charles Lamb
It's my rule never to lose me temper till it would be dethrimental to keep it. Sean O'Casey
When angry, count four; when very angry, swear. Mark Twain
Anger is the only thing to put off till tomorrow. Slovakian Proverb
Temper is the one thing you can’t get rid of by losing it. Jack Nicholson
Take this remark from Richard, poor and lame, what'er's begun in anger ends in shame. Benjamin Franklin
A wrathful man stirreth up strife: but he that is slow to anger appeaseth strife. Proverbs 15:18
It is a bigger miracle to be patient and refrain from anger than it is to control the demons which fly through the air. St. John Cassian
There is nothing that can be done with anger that cannot be done better without it. Dallas Willard
Resentment is when you let your hurt become hate. Resentment is when you allow what is eating you to eat you up. Resentment is when you poke, stoke, feed, and fan the fire, stirring the flames and reliving the pain. Resentment is the deliberate decision to nurse the offense until it becomes a black, furry, growling grudge. Max Lucado
Hot heads and cold hearts never solved anything. Billy Graham

Consider how much more you often suffer from your anger and grief than from those very things for which you are angry and grieved. Marcus Aurelius
Bitterness is like cancer. It eats upon the host. But anger is like fire. It burns all clean. Maya Angelou
Be ye angry, and sin not: let not the sun go down upon your wrath. Ephesians 4:26
He who conquers his anger has conquered an enemy. German Proverb
Kick a stone in anger and you will hurt your own foot. Korean Proverb
Anger dwells only in the bosom of fools. Albert Einstein
Let us not look back in anger, nor forward in fear, but around in awareness. James Thurber
Man should forget his anger before he lies down to sleep. Mahatma Gandhi
Always write angry letters to your enemies. Never mail them. James Fallows
Do not weep; do not wax indignant. Understand. Baruch Spinoza
Never go to bed mad. Stay up and fight. Phyllis Diller
It’s smart to be patient, but it’s stupid to lose your temper. Proverbs 14:29
Speak when you are angry and you will make the best speech you will ever regret. Ambrose Bierce
There is no sin nor wrong that gives a man such a foretaste of hell in this life as anger and impatience. St. Catherine of Siena
To build one’s activity on love and non-violence demands the greatest inner purification; one must constantly rid one’s heart of inordinate desires, fears, and anxieties, but above all, one must cleanse oneself of anger. William Johnston
